A Houthi delegation arrived in Moscow to discuss “the need to increase efforts to pressure” the US and Israel to end the Gaza war, a spokesman for the Yemeni rebels said. Mohammed Abdel Salam said that the group met deputy Russian foreign minister Mikhail Bogdanov to discuss the conflict in Gaza, he said in a statement on X. He said the meeting discussed the US and British strikes on the Houthis in Yemen.
